A fresh collaboration involving the National Black Chamber of Commerce (NBCC), its Africa Federation Initiative, D Evans Consulting Inc. and IPADA Initiatives is set to strengthen economic and business engagement between African and American interests.
The development is contained in a Memorandum of Understanding involving the organisations, with NBCC President and Chief Executive Officer, Charles H. DeBow III, representing the chamber in the agreement.
D Evans Consulting Inc. is also listed as a strategic partner, with its President and Chief Executive Officer, Darlene D. Evans, representing the organisation.

IPADA Initiatives, founded by Dr. Otunba Wanle Akinboboye, is listed as another party to the agreement, with Akinboboye named as its representative.

The partnership brings together organisations with interests in business development, international collaboration and Africa-focused economic engagement, creating a platform for deeper cooperation between stakeholders across the two regions.
The agreement also makes reference to the Nigerian Association of Chambers of Commerce, Industry, Mines and Agriculture (NACCIMA), with matters concerning the organisation to be addressed separately under the arrangement.

The MOU provides for the representatives of the participating organisations to formally execute the agreement, with the document identifying the respective officials authorised to sign on behalf of their organisations.
